diff options
Diffstat (limited to '')
| -rw-r--r-- | app/Main.hs | 9 |
1 files changed, 4 insertions, 5 deletions
diff --git a/app/Main.hs b/app/Main.hs index b684ac3..7ad73a1 100644 --- a/app/Main.hs +++ b/app/Main.hs @@ -29,7 +29,7 @@ import Data.Vector (Vector) import qualified Data.Vector as V import GHC.Base (Alternative ((<|>))) import qualified Network.HTTP.Client as Client -import qualified Network.HTTP.Client.OpenSSL as Client +import qualified Network.HTTP.Client.Rustls as Client import Network.HTTP.Types import Network.Wai import Network.Wai.Handler.Warp (run) @@ -311,7 +311,6 @@ main = do let cacheTime = 3600 * 24 * 7 -- one week platformCache <- newTVarIO mempty - Client.withOpenSSL $ do - clientManager <- Client.newOpenSSLManager - putStrLn "Starting Server" - run 8080 (logStdoutDev (app AppData{..})) + clientManager <- Client.newRustlsManager + putStrLn "Starting Server" + run 8080 (logStdoutDev (app AppData{..})) |
